Camis

/ˈkæm.iz/ noun

Definition

Plural of cami; short for camisoles or camise, sleeveless or short-sleeved women's undergarments or informal tops.

Etymology

Short plural of camisole, from French 'camisole' derived from Spanish 'camisola,' ultimately from Latin 'camisia' meaning shirt.
